Item Attention deficit hyperactivity disorder and other disruptive behavior disorders are risk factors for recurrent epistaxis in children: A prospective case-controlled study(Turkish Journal of Pediatrics, 2016) Özgür E.; Aksu H.; Gürbüz-Özgür B.; Başak H.S.; Eskiizmir G.The aim of this study was to investigate the frequency of attention deficit hyperactivity disorder (ADHD) and other disruptive behavior disorders in children with recurrent epistaxis (RE). Children aged between 6-11 years were enrolled according to presence (n=34) and absence (n=103) of RE. Turgay DSM-IV-Based Child and Adolescent Disruptive Behavior Disorders Screening and Rating Scale was applied to parents. Moreover, Schedule for Affective Disorders and Schizophrenia for School-Age Children Present and Lifetime Version was performed. Oppositional defiant disorder (ODD) and ADHD were determined in 17.6% and 32.4% of patients, respectively. When psychiatric diagnoses between both groups were compared, statistically significant differences were found in terms of ADHD and ODD (p=0.028 and p=0.003). In children with RE, the frequency of ADHD and ODD are higher than children without RE. A referral to a child psychiatrist should be considered, if a child with RE also has symptoms of increased activity, inattention and/or body-injurious behaviors. © 2016, Turkish Journal of Pediatrics. Methods: A total of 162 cases aged between 2-18 years diagnosed with pervaisive developmental disorders according to DSM-IV-TR criteria and their parents enrolled to study. QoLA, Autism Behavior Checklist, KINDL-parent version, WHOQOL-BREF, sociodemographic, and Clinical Global Impression Scale were applied to caregivers. Item-total correlation, ceilig/floor effect, internal consistency and test-retest were used for reliability analysis. Construct and criterion validity were applied for validity analysis. Exploratory factor analysis was conducted using an exploratory approach to create an idea of the possible dimensions of part A and B which are indexes (not dimensions) in the original version. Results: Thirty-four of the patients (21%) were female and 128 (79%) were male. The mean age of all patients was 6.3±4.0 years. Cronbach’s alpha coefficient was 0.928 for QoLA Part A and 0.944 for Section B. Intraclass correlation coefficient was detected 0.68 and 0.76 for Part A and B in test-retest, respectively. Positive correlation was found between Part A scores and all dimensions of WHOQOL-BREF as well as Part B scores and school, friends, other and total scores of KINDL-parent proxy version. As the severity of the disease increased, relevant sections scores of the questionnaire was found to be worsening according to the criterion validity (sensi-tivity) analysis results. Six dimensions for Part A and 3 dimensions for Part B was detected by using exploratory factor analysis. Conclusion: The psychometric properties of the Turkish form of QoLA is highly valid and reliable. When examining distrubitons of items in 6 dimensions of Part A, dimensions can be named as independence, psychological-emotional well-being, social relations and environment, physical and economic and financial situation. For Part B, it was observed that 3 dimensions attributed DSM-5 diagnostic criteria of ASD. QoLA is suggested to use to evaluate quality of life of parents with ASD diagnosed children and to detect the effects of treatment interventions on quality of life. © 2017, Cukurova University, Faculty of Medicine. Aims: It was aimed to evaluate the effect of the variables related to both parents and children on the QoL scores of the parents of the children with ASD. Settings and Design: This is a causality analysis study. Subjects and Methods: Questionnaire on sociodemographic/disease-related variables, QoL in Autism Questionnaire-Parent Version (QoLA-P), autism behavior checklist and Clinical Global Impression scale were assessed of 162 patients with ASD. Statistical Analysis Used: Unpaired t-Test, Mann-Whitney U test, Kruskal-Wallis test, and one-way ANOVA test were used for comparing groups. The parameters found to be statistically significant for QoLA-P in different analyses were included as the independent variable in the logistic regression analysis. The backward (variable elimination) model was selected as the model in the analysis. Results: The causality has been established may be stated as the severity of autism, the presence of psychiatric disorder in the mother/father, attendance of the child at school, duration since the diagnosis of autism, and the child's medication use. Conclusions: Autism affects the QoL of caregivers. The intervention of treatment by considering the factors that affect the QoL positively or negatively may increase the QoL of caregivers. © 2018 Medknow. Methods: This study was conducted as a part of the “The Epidemiology of Childhood Psychopathology in Turkey” (EPICPAT-T) Study, which was designed by the Turkish Association of Child and Adolescent Mental Health. The inclusion criterion was being a student between the second and fourth grades in the schools assigned as study centers. The assessment tools used were the K-SADS-PL, and a sociodemographic form that was designed by the authors. Impairment was assessed via a 3 point-Likert type scale independently rated by a parent and a teacher. Results: A total of 5842 participants were included in the analyses. The prevalence of affective disorders was 2.5 % without considering impairment and 1.6 % when impairment was taken into account. In our sample, the diagnosis of bipolar disorder was lacking, thus depressive disorders constituted all the cases. Among depressive disorders with impairment, major depressive disorder (MDD) (prevalence of 1.06%) was the most common, followed by dysthymia (prevalence of 0.2%), adjustment disorder with depressive features (prevalence of 0.17%), and depressive disorder-NOS (prevalence of 0.14%). There were no statistically significant gender differences for depression. Maternal psychopathology and paternal physical illness were predictors of affective disorders with pervasive impairment. Conclusion: MDD was the most common depressive disorder among Turkish children in this nationwide epidemiological study. This highlights the severe nature of depression and the importance of early interventions. Populations with maternal psychopathology and paternal physical illness may be the most appropriate targets for interventions to prevent and treat depression in children and adolescents. © 2018Item The prevalence of childhood psychopathology in Turkey: a cross-sectional multicenter nationwide study (EPICPAT-T)(Taylor and Francis Ltd, 2019) Ercan E.S.; Polanczyk G.; Akyol Ardıc U.; Yuce D.; Karacetın G.; Tufan A.E.; Tural U.; Aksu H.; Aktepe E.; Rodopman Arman A.; Başgül S.; Bılac O.; Coşkun M.; Celık G.G.; Karakoc Demırkaya S.; Dursun B.O.; Durukan İ.; Fidan T.; Perdahlı Fiş N.; Gençoğlan S.; Gökçen C.; Görker I.; Görmez V.; Gündoğdu Ö.Y.; Gürkan C.K.; Hergüner S.; Tural Hesapçıoğlu S.; Kandemir H.; Kılıç B.G.; Kılınçaslan A.; Mutluer T.; Nasiroğlu S.; Özel Özcan Ö.; Öztürk M.; Öztop D.; Yalın Sapmaz S.; Süren S.; Şahin N.; Yolga Tahıroglu A.; Toros F.; Ünal F.; Vural P.; Perçinel Yazıcı İ.; Yazıcı K.U.; Yıldırım V.; Yulaf Y.; Yüce M.; Yüksel T.; Akdemir D.; Altun H.; Ayık B.; Bilgic A.; Hekim Bozkurt Ö.; Demirbaş Çakır E.; Çeri V.; Üçok Demir N.; Dinç G.; Irmak M.Y.; Karaman D.; Kınık M.F.; Mazlum B.; Memik N.Ç.; Foto Özdemir D.; Sınır H.; Ince Taşdelen B.; Taşkın B.; Uğur Ç.; Uran P.; Uysal T.; Üneri Ö.; Yilmaz S.; Seval Yılmaz S.; Açıkel B.; Aktaş H.; Alaca R.; Alıç B.G.; Almaidan M.; Arı F.P.; Aslan C.; Atabay E.; Ay M.G.; Aydemir H.; Ayrancı G.; Babadagı Z.; Bayar H.; Çon Bayhan P.; Bayram Ö.; Dikmeer Bektaş N.; Berberoğlu K.K.; Bostan R.; Arıcı Canlı M.; Cansız M.A.; Ceylan C.; Coşkun N.; Coşkun S.; Çakan Y.; Demir İ.; Demir N.; Yıldırım Demirdöğen E.; Doğan B.; Dönmez Y.E.; Dönder F.; Efe A.; Eray Ş.; Erbilgin S.; Erden S.; Ersoy E.G.; Eseroğlu T.; Kına Fırat S.; Eynallı Gök E.; Güler G.; Güles Z.; Güneş S.; Güneş A.; Günay G.; Gürbüz Özgür B.; Güven G.; Çelik Göksoy Ş.; Horozcu H.; Irmak A.; Işık Ü.; Kahraman Ö.; Kalaycı B.M.; Karaaslan U.; Karadağ M.; Kılıc H.T.; Kılıçaslan F.; Kınay D.; Kocael Ö.; Bulanık Koç E.; Kadir Mutlu R.; Lushi-Şan Z.; Nalbant K.; Okumus N.; Özbek F.; Akkuş Özdemir F.; Özdemir H.; Özkan S.; Yıldırım Özyurt E.; Polat B.; Polat H.; Sekmen E.; Sertçelik M.; Sevgen F.H.; Sevince O.; Süleyman F.; Shamkhalova Ü.; Eren Şimşek N.; Tanır Y.; Tekden M.; Temtek S.; Topal M.; Topal Z.; Türk T.; Uçar H.N.; Uçar F.; Uygun D.; Uzun N.; Vatansever Z.; Yazgılı N.G.; Miniksar Yıldız D.; Yıldız N.Aim: The aim of this study was to determine the prevalence of childhood psychopathologies in Turkey. Method: A nation-wide, randomly selected, representative population of 5830 children (6–13 years-old) enrolled as a 2nd,3rd or 4th grade student in 30 cities were evaluated for presence of a psychiatric or mental disorder by a Sociodemographic Form, Kiddie Schedule for Affective Disorders and Schizophrenia for School Age Children-Present and Lifetime Version (K-SADS-PL), and DSM-IV-Based Screening Scale for Disruptive Behavior Disorders in Children and Adolescents scales. Impairment criterion was assessed via a 3 point-Likert scale by the parent and the teacher independently. Results: Overall prevalence of any psychopathology was 37.6% without impairment criterion, and 17.1% with impairment criterion. Attention-deficit hyperactivity disorder was the most frequent diagnosis, followed by anxiety (19.5% and 16.7% without impairment, 12.4% and 5.3% with impairment, respectively). Lower education level and presence of a physical or psychiatric problem of the parents were independent predictors of any psychopathology of the offspring. Conclusion: This is the largest and most comprehensive epidemiological study to determine the prevalence of psychopathologies in children and adolescents in Turkey. Our results partly higher than, and partly comparable to previous national and international studies. It also contributes to the literature by determining the independent predictors of psychopathologies in this age group. © 2019, © 2019 The Nordic Psychiatric Association.Item Validity and reliability of the Turkish version of the knowledge about childhood autism among health workers questionnaire(Taylor and Francis Ltd., 2019) Gürbüz Özgür B.; Aksu H.; Eser E.Objective: The aim of this study is to present the psychometric properties of the Turkish version of the knowledge about childhood autism among health workers (KCAHW) questionnaire. Methods: Three hundred fifteen primary health care facility workers and 28 child and adolescent mental health professionals were enrolled in this study. Participants filled out socio-demographic data forms and the KCAHW. Reliability analyses consisted of internal consistency and test–retest reliability. For validity analysis, construct validity (confirmatory factor analysis -CFA) and criterion validity were used. Results: The mean KCAHW questionnaire score was 13.83 ± 2.55. The floor effects in all domains were below 15%, the ceiling effects were over 15% in overall score and in Domain 4. Intraclass correlation coefficient and the Kuder Richardson 21 values were 0.83 and 0.683, respectively; All goodness of fit indices generated by CFA were found satisfactory (Comparative fit index = 0.79; Root mean square error of approximation = 0.056, and chi-square/degree of freedom = 1.91). Being a physician, being a CAMH specialist, having mental health clinic experience, having done a child psychiatry internship, knowing someone diagnosed with autism, follow-up experience of a patient with autism, having previous autism training, and the perception of adequate knowledge about autism, significantly increased the KCAHW scores (p < 0.001). Conclusion: The Turkish version of the KCAHW questionnaire is reliable (in terms of test-retest and internal consistency) and valid (sensitive some known/expected external criteria). Due to the insufficient internal consistency in Domain 4, the scores received from Domain 4 should be evaluated with caution. © 2019, © 2019 The Author(s). Method: The inclusion criterion was being enrolled as a 2nd, 3rd, or 4th-grade student. A semi-structured diagnostic interview (K-SADS-PL), DSM-IV-Based Screening Scale for Disruptive Behavior Disorders, and assessment of impairment (by both parents and teachers) were applied to 5,842 participants. Results: The prevalence of ADHD was 19.5% without impairment and 12.4% with impairment. Both ADHD with and without impairment groups had similar psychiatric comorbidity rates except for oppositional defiant disorder (ODD) and conduct disorder (CD) diagnoses. Impairment in the ADHD group resulted in significantly higher ODD and CD diagnoses. Conclusion: Even when impairment is not described, other psychiatric disorders accompany the diagnosis of ADHD and may cause impairment in the future. Impairment in the diagnosis of ADHD significantly increases the likelihood of ODD and CD. © ©The Author(s) 2021.Item Prevalence, comorbidities and mediators of childhood anxiety disorders in urban Turkey: a national representative epidemiological study(Springer Science and Business Media Deutschland GmbH, 2023) Mutluer T.; Gorker I.; Akdemir D.; Ozdemir D.F.; Ozel O.O.; Vural P.; Tufan A.E.; Karacetin G.; Arman A.R.; Fis N.P.; Demirci E.; Ozmen S.; Hesapcioglu S.T.; Oztop D.; Tural U.; Aktepe E.; Aksu H.; Ardic U.A.; Basgul S.; Bilac O.; Coskun M.; Celik G.G.; Demirkaya S.K.; Dursun O.B.; Durukan I.; Fidan T.; Gokcen C.; Gormez V.; Gundogdu O.Y.; Herguner S.; Kandemir H.; Kilic B.G.; Kilincaslan A.; Nasiroglu S.; Sapmaz S.Y.; Sahin N.; Tahiroglu A.Y.; Toros F.; Unal F.; Yazici I.P.; Yazici K.U.; Isik U.; Ercan E.S.Purpose: The aim of this study is to evaluate the prevalence of anxiety disorders, its correlation with sociodemographic characteristics, its comorbidities with other psychiatric disorders and its predictors in school-aged children. Methods: This study is part of a representative, multi-centered national study that is planned by the Turkish Association of Child and Adolescent Mental Health to evaluate the prevalence of psychopathology among elementary school students in Turkey between the years 2014–2015. Children are screened via Kiddie Schedule for Affective Disorders and Schizophrenia for School Age Children Present and Lifetime Version. Impairment is assessed by a 3-point Likert type scale independently by the parent and the teacher. The final sample included 5842 children with the mean age of 8.7 years. Results: The prevalence of any anxiety disorder without considering impairment is 16.7% and considering impairment is 5.2% in children according to our study. We found significant differences for comorbid Attention Deficit Hyperactivity Disorder, Disruptive Behavior Disorder, Mood Disorders, Tic Disorders, Obsessive Compulsive Disorder, Enuresis Nocturna, Encopresis, and Intellectual Disability. Having a history of paternal physical disorder, living in the regions of Marmara, Mediterranean and Black Sea were found to be the main predictors of having childhood anxiety disorders according to the logistic regression analysis. Conclusion: Better understanding of childhood anxiety disorders, comorbid conditions and predictors will result in earlier diagnosis and more appropriate treatment. © 2022, The Author(s), under exclusive licence to Springer-Verlag GmbH Germany.
